Justice Minister Gürlek sends 'independent judiciary' message at HSK iftar program: An indispensable principle

Justice Minister Akın Gürlek attended the iftar program organized by the Council of Judges and Prosecutors (HSK). Addressing HSK members and staff, Minister Gürlek stated that Ramadan is also a month of self-reflection and a climate of purification.

Stating that justice begins in the conscience above all else, is shaped by law, and comes to life through rulings, Minister Gürlek noted that members of the judiciary carry a heavy trust.

Minister Gürlek said, "As a colleague who has come from within this organization, I say this with peace of mind: The duty of the judiciary requires not only knowledge but also patience, dignity, and a strong conscience.

The Council of Judges and Prosecutors is the institutional guarantor of this great trust. Every decision made by our Council is not just an appointment or promotion process, but also a determination of direction for the future of our judicial organization. In this respect, our responsibility is great."

In his speech, Minister Gürlek used the expressions, "Judicial independence is not a wish for us, but an indispensable principle. A strong judiciary stands tall with strong institutions and strong professional honor."

"Protecting the dignity and professional honor of our judicial organization is our common duty"

Minister Gürlek expressed that he is aware of the workload on the judicial organization and continued his speech as follows:

"I know the weight of societal expectations. I also see how the climate of debate that occasionally forms over the judiciary tires you, but be assured of this: This organization is not left without an owner. Protecting the professional security of each of you, strengthening merit, and preserving the prestige of judicial service are our priorities. Protecting the dignity and professional honor of our judicial organization is our common duty. Justice is not only about making the right decision; it is also about ensuring that society believes that decision is fair. Trust is our most valuable asset."
